+[* black] To remove the keyboard, turn the system right side up.
+[* black] Unlock the latch above the F8 key at the top of the keyboard by prying up towards you.
+[* black] Lift the keyboard out from the top, until you can see the keyboard FPC (Flexible Printed Circuit) cable.
+[* black] Carefully pull out the keyboard cable. ''Note: If you are not sure you will be able to get the cable back in the correct way, mark the cable and the socket with a sharpie.''
+[* black] Set the keyboard down in a clean flat space.
